On average across the year,
yes, Costa Rica is hotter than
Utica, New York
.
Costa Rica has an average temperature of 25°C/77°F and Utica, New York has an average temperature of 6°C/43°F.
Costa Rica's hottest month is April,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F, which is hotter than Utica, New York's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 25°C/77°F).

On average across the year,
no, Costa Rica has less rain than
Utica, New York. Costa Rica has an average annual rainfall of 1358mm and Utica, New York has an average annual rainfall of 1663mm.
Costa Rica's wettest month is October, with an average monthly rainfall of 212mm, which is wetter than Utica, New York's wettest month (also October, with an average monthly rainfall of 188mm).

Yes, Costa Rica is more populated than Utica.
Costa Rica has a population of 5,204,411 and Utica has a population of 61,100
which means that Costa Rica has 5,143,311 more people than Utica.
That makes Costa Rica 85 times more populated than Utica.
